Technical SEO for International Websites: Structuring for Achievement

To truly reach a international audience, your website architecture needs meticulous attention. Organizing your site effectively isn't just about appealing users; it's about ensuring search engines like Google can crawl and categorize your content. This involves a solid XML sitemap, carefully crafted URL structures that are both user-friendly and SEO optimized – typically using localized domains or subdirectories – and ensuring proper hreflang tags are implemented to tell search engines which language and region your content targets. Furthermore, consider optimizing your website's speed and performance, including mobile optimization, which is a vital factor in appearing in search results. Ignoring these backend aspects can severely restrict your website's visibility and growth in key international markets.
